Easttown Library & Information Center may provide for the distribution, display or posting of free public materials (including handouts, flyers, posters, advertisements, brochures, or other materials) for public awareness. Consistent with the Library Bill of Rights, these items may represent diverse points of view.
Posted information and displays are limited to:
- Educational information
- Artistic/cultural programs and services
- Information from or about community or civic organizations
- Material from other organizations that partner with the Easttown Library
The following types of information may not be posted or displayed:
- Free public material by for-profit concerns
- Proselytizing materials
- Partisan political materials (the exception to this is on election days, when partisan political posters may be displayed, but only when Easttown Library serves as a polling place)
Except in unusual circumstances, fund-raising advertisements and activities will be limited to those that directly benefit the Easttown Library, the Easttown Library Foundation, the Friends of the Library or the Chester County Library System.
The Easttown Library welcomes exhibits in the display case, provided that they are of general interest and serve to inform or enrich the community. Procedures for the use of the display case are available at the Circulation Desk.
No free public materials may be placed in the Library without advance permission of the Library Director or the Director's designee. The location for placing materials is at the discretion of library staff. Materials must be left at the Circulation Desk for approval. The Easttown Library reserves the right to remove any material, including previously approved material, at any time and for any reason, including general appearance or timeliness.
Members of the community may voice concerns about the selection or rejection of free public materials for display or distribution using the General Complaint Form which is available at the Circulation Desk.
Approval to distribute, display or post free public materials does not indicate that Easttown Library endorses a particular idea, cause, organization, or activity, nor does denial of approval indicate the converse.
